Source code for qsppack.objective

"""Objective and gradient functions for QSP optimization.

This module provides functions for computing objective values and gradients
needed in QSP optimization problems.
"""

import numpy as np
from .utils import (
    get_unitary_sym, get_pim_sym, get_pim_sym_real,
    get_pim_deri_sym, get_pim_deri_sym_real, get_entry
)

[docs]def obj_sym(phi, delta, opts): """Compute objective function value for QSP optimization. Parameters ---------- phi : array_like Phase factors for QSP circuit delta : array_like Samples opts : dict Options dictionary containing target function and parameters Returns ------- float Objective function value """ m = len(delta) obj = np.zeros(m) for i in range(m): qspmat = get_unitary_sym(phi, delta[i], opts['parity']) obj[i] = 0.5 * (np.real(qspmat[0, 0]) - opts['target']([delta[i]]))**2 return obj
